Short duplex RNA units,mostly referred as small interfering RNAs (siRNAs),are regarded as the most powerfil tool in post-transcriptional gene silencing [1].However,the structural incompetency of siRNAs to form stable and effective nano-complexes with cationic pelymers still remains a major hurdle towards their clinical application.The functional adaptability of RNAi (RNA interference) machinery to accommodate unconventional RNA triggers have paved its way for the development of novel structural variants,devised to overcome the limitations posed by classical siRNA format.
